Description

Contains corrections for numpy inputs from #2275

Column order oneDAL datatables are converted into C-contiguous numpy arrays, which is a false transpose of data. Recursion checks on data can lead to an infinite loop, a safety boolean is added to allow for it to occur once. More informative errors are added, rather than a generic errors.
